If Your Website Is Not Generating Leads, Something Is Missing
If your website is not generating leads, the problem is not just traffic. In most cases, the issue is how your website is structured, what it communicates and how it guides users.
A business website should attract, inform and convert. If it is not doing that, it is underperforming.
Why your website is not generating leads
Your website could not be generating leads due to unclear messaging, weak conversion design, slow performance, or lack of relevant content.
These issues can prevent users from understanding your offer and taking action.
Your Website Lacks a Clear Message
When someone lands on your website, they should immediately understand:
- What your business does
- Who your services are for
- Why they should choose you
If this is not clear within seconds, users inevitably leave. Search engines and AI platforms also rely on this clarity to understand your business and recommend it.

Your Design Is Not Built for Conversion
A website can look modern and still fail. Your design must guide users toward action.
This includes:
- Clear layout and structure
- Logical navigation
- Visible and consistent calls to action
If users do not know what to do next, they will not convert.
There Is No Clear Conversion Path
What should a visitor do after landing on your site?
If the answer is not obvious, your website has a conversion problem.
Common issues include:
- Weak or missing calls to action
- Contact forms that are hard to find
- No logical flow from section to section
Every page should lead the user toward a clear next step.
Your Website Is Not Optimized for AI Search
How does AI decide which websites to recommend?
AI systems prioritize content that is clear, structured, and directly answers questions. If your website does not explain your services properly or lacks useful information, it will not be selected.
To improve AI visibility, your content must:
- Answer real user questions
- Be easy to scan
- Be logically organized
Your Website Is Too Slow
A slow website directly reduces leads.
If your site takes too long to load:
- Users leave before interacting
- Engagement drops
- Conversions decrease
Speed is not just technical. It affects revenue.
Your Content Strategy Is Too Weak
Why does content matter for lead generation?
Because users need information before making decisions. If your website only has basic service pages, it is not enough.
You need:
- Detailed service explanations
- Pages that answer common questions
- Content about pricing, process, and expectations
- Location relevant content
This builds trust and improves visibility in both Google and AI platforms.
Your Website Is Not Being Updated
Websites that do not evolve lose visibility. Search engines and AI tools prioritize updated, relevant content.
If your website has not been improved in months or years, it will fall behind competitors.
How to fix a website that is not generating leads
Clarify your value proposition
Your homepage should clearly explain what you offer and who you serve. Avoid generic phrases. Be specific.
Design with conversion in mind
Every section of your website should have a purpose.
Use:
- Clear calls to action
- Structured layouts
- Simple navigation
Make it easy for users to take action.
Create AI friendly content
Content should be easy to read and easy to extract.
Use:
- Clear headings
- Short paragraphs
- Direct answers
This improves both SEO and AI visibility.
Improve website performance
Focus on:
- Faster loading times
- Optimized images
- Reliable hosting
Better performance leads to better results.
Build a strong content strategy
Create content that answers real questions your customers have.
Focus on:
- Services
- Costs
- Processes
- Common problems
This positions your business as a trusted source.

Summary –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Why is my website not generating leads?
Most websites fail to generate leads because they do not clearly communicate their value or guide users toward action. In many cases, visitors leave because they are confused, cannot find what they need, or are not given a clear next step such as contacting the business or requesting a quote.
How do I fix a website that is not converting?
Start by reviewing how users interact with your site. Improve your messaging so it is clear within seconds, add strong and visible calls to action, simplify navigation, and remove anything that creates friction.
Even small changes in structure and clarity can significantly improve conversions.
Does web design affect lead generation?
Yes, but not just visually. Effective web design is about how information is structured and how easily users can take action.
A well designed site reduces confusion, builds trust, and makes it simple for visitors to contact you or request a service.
Can SEO help generate more leads?
SEO helps bring the right people to your website, but traffic alone is not enough. To generate leads, your website must match user intent, provide useful information, and guide visitors toward taking action once they arrive.
